Output d5a9e52caa956c436ba1218685fb4ba1cfcc49cb80ac266df72d534fcb9f09bd:1

value
24138692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c745a23ec47fe4fc5f483aa9784222e43f44f823 OP_EQUAL
address
3KrfoxUDuG8SbX5ng27Yv6LmBTkrKZ24fA
transaction
d5a9e52caa956c436ba1218685fb4ba1cfcc49cb80ac266df72d534fcb9f09bd
spent
true